Inflection
Indefinite declension of цёра
| singular | plural | |
|---|---|---|
| nominative | цёра (ćora) | цёрат (ćorat) |
| genitive | цёрань (ćorań) | — |
| dative | цёранди (ćoranďi) | — |
| ablative | цёрада (ćorada) | — |
| inessive | цёраса (ćorasa) | — |
| elative | цёраста (ćorasta) | — |
| illative | цёрас (ćoras) | — |
| prolative | цёрава (ćorava) | — |
| comparative | цёрашка (ćoraška) | — |
| translative | цёракс (ćoraks) | — |
| abessive | цёрафтома (ćoraftoma) | — |
| causative | цёранкса (ćoranksa) | — |
Definite declension of цёра
| singular | plural | |
|---|---|---|
| nominative | цёрась (ćoraś) | цёратне (ćoratńe) |
| genitive | цёрать (ćorať) | цёратнень (ćoratńeń) |
| dative | цёрати (ćoraťi) | цёратненди (ćoratńenďi) |
